It seems the Grocery Embiggen Ray, the antithesis of the Grocery Shrink Ray, has struck Safeway Select ice cream and they’re offering up a whole two quarts, just like ice cream makers used to all do back in the old timey days.
It’s been a long time since ice cream came in real half-gallon sizes. Years ago, most manufacturers went down to 1.75 and even 1.5 quarts, with Blue Bell as one of the lone holdouts.
